  • Issue #2
    Weird Space (2000) 2
    Published 2000 by ACG.

    This item is not in stock at MyComicShop. If you use the "Add to want list" tab to add this issue to your want list, we will email you when it becomes available.

    Cover by Basil Wolverton. Edited by Roger Broughton. Stories by Richard Hughes (credited as Lafcadio Lee) and Basil Wolverton. Art by Ogden Whitney, John Rosenberger and Basil Wolverton. A collection of sci-fi and horror tales from classic 1950s comics, featuring art by comics legend Basil Wolverton. A scientist's new formula makes nightmares come true; American astronauts are stranded in space after Soviets take over the world; A teen gets a chance to join the first rocket trip to the moon. Featuring reprints from Weird Tales of the Future and ACGs Adventures into the Unknown. Another terrific Wolverton alien cover. Nightmare World; Journey to the Moon; Judas Goat! 32 pages, B&W. Cover price $2.95.

  • Issue #2
    Weird Tales of the Future (1952) 2

    Cover by Basil Wolverton. Stories and art by Ed Smalle and Basil Wolverton. Pre-Code tales of science fiction and horror from Stanley Morse Publications. A killer volunteers to be placed in suspended animation for 20,000 years rather than be executed. A future criminal plots his escape from an intergalactic labor camp. Plus the first adventure of whimsical spacefaring hero Jumpin' Jupiter. Stories and a classic city-smashing monster cover by comics legend Basil Wolverton. The City of Primitive Man; Flight to the Future; Jumpin' Jupiter; Flying Saucers, Meteors, or What?; The Time Has Come; Escape to Death! 36 pages, Full Color. Cover price $0.10.

  • Issue #2
    Weird Tales of the Macabre (1975) 2

    Macabre comics and stories, including an adventure of Bog Beast, a Swamp Thing knockoff who also appeared in the comic Tales of Evil. Stories and art by Al Moniz, Gabe Levy, George Kashdan, Pat Boyette, Leo Summers, John Severin, Badia Romero and Spanish artist Xirinius. Also, an article on the films of Edgar Allen Poe. Part of the short-lived Atlas line from former Marvel publisher Martin Goodman. Magazine format. Black and white; 64 pages. Cover by Boris Vallejo. Cover price $0.75.

  • Issue #2
    Weird Comics (1940) 2

    Cover by Lou Fine. Edited by Victor Fox. Stories and art by Pierce Rice, Arturo Cazeneuve, Louis Cazeneuve, Don Rico, Fred Schwab, Bert Whitman, Allan Spectre, Arnold Mazos, and Phllips Judge. An anthology of science fiction, horror and adventure comics from Fox. This is as pulpy as it gets. Grant and Glenda are shipwrecked in mine-heavy waters until he calls on the power of Thor; Undersea explorer Typhon and his crew are captured by the hideous mermen; Bird Man battles giant reptiles that threaten the peace of a primitive canyon tribe. Thor; Sorceress of Zoom; Solar Plexis; Blast Bennett; Dr. Mortal; Voodoo Man; The Speaking Rock; Bird Man; Typhon. 64 pages, Full Color. Cover price $0.10.

  • Issue #2
    Weird Thrillers (1951) 2

    Painted cover by Allen Anderson. Stories and art by Gene Colan, Murphy Anderson, Alex Toth, Sy Barry, Henry Sharp, and Joe Genovese. Classic 1950s science-fiction and horror tales from Ziff-Davis. A cosmic Fisherman From Space catches humans and leaves them on an island where they never grow old, in a story with art by comics legend Alex Toth. A crook steals a time machine and Grandfather Paradoxes himself, in a story with art by comics legend Murphy Anderson. A man buys a horror mask to scare his wealthy uncle to death, but faces a grim comeuppance, in a story with early art by Marvel legend Gene Colan. Weird painted cover by Allen Anderson. Weird Worlds; The Fisherman of Space; The Last Man; Destiny Takes the Long Road; The Cycle of Time; Murderer's Mask; Headed for the Stars; Metals for the Future. 32 pages, Full Color. Cover price $0.10.

  • Issue #2 (13)
    Weird Science (1950 E.C.) Canadian Edition 2 (13)
    Published 1950 (est.) by EC.

    Canadian edition. Cover by Al Feldstein. Stories by Harvey Kurtzman, Bill Gaines and Al Feldstein. Art by Harvey Kurtzman, Jack Kamen, Harry Harrison, Wally Wood and Al Feldstein. Canadian publisher Superior reprints EC's influential New Trend title, featuring some legendary sci-fi and comics artists. A scientist who's jealous of a rival's new job and bride uses a strange new invention to get even, in a story by Harvey Kurtzman. A blind person is the only one immune to an invading alien's hypnotic powers, with art by Harry Harrison and Wally Wood. Feldstein and Gaines examine the real-life "flying saucer" phenomenon that swept America in the 1950s. Classic cover by Al Feldstein. The Flying Saucer Invasion; The Meteor Monster; Experiment; The Micro Race!; Sands of Time; The Man Who Raced Time. 32 pages, Full Color. Cover price $0.10.
